Ebenezer Cole 1745–1794 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 5 Aug 1745

Birth Location: Rehoboth, Bristol Co., Massachusetts

Death Date: 22 March 1794

Death Location: Shaftsbury, Bennington, Vermont, United States

Father: Israel Cole

Mother: Susanna Wheaton

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1745, Ebenezer Cole entered the world in Rehoboth, Bristol Co., Massachusetts, born to Israel Cole And Susanna Wheaton. Ebenezer Cole passed away in 1794 in Shaftsbury, Bennington, Vermont, United States.
